Flying Salt Lake City

Salt Lake City International sets Class B over the valley, and terrain does the rest. Mountain flying brings density altitude, sudden wind and canyon effects that meaningfully change what a drone can lift and how long it can stay up. This is the market where aircraft selection matters most.

Aerial Cinematography in Salt Lake City — questions we get

Can your aerial footage match our A camera?

That is most of the job. We shoot to match your capture format and color pipeline so the aerial cuts in without a grade fight. If your show is on a specific body, tell us in prep and we will build around it.

What can a drone do in Salt Lake City that a helicopter cannot?

Fly low, fly close, fly inside, and cost a fraction. A helicopter still wins on altitude, endurance and long lens work over open ground. Any vendor who tells you drones replaced helicopters entirely is selling you something.

Do you work as part of the camera department?

Yes, and it matters. An aerial unit parked to one side as a novelty produces novelty shots. One that sits inside the camera department produces coverage the editor can actually cut with.
